Build The Woods | New Site

14 December 2009, 23.24 | Posted in blogs, bmx, websites | No comments »

Rad Collector - Build The Woods New Site
The new Build the Woods site has just launched. Built by Elwood Ruffle from Seventies Distribution, the design mastermind who also helped launch the new Hoffman site this year, Build The Woods is a UK based blog supported by some of the best UK, US, Canadian and New Zealander trail builders and a motivational tool for anyone to get inspired to dig for some sky. The Big Push 2009

14 September 2009, 12.56 | Posted in Skateboarding, contests | No comments »


More the-big-push Skateboarding >>
Starting tomorrow, it’s gonna be like WW3 over in the UK with the Big Push 2009. The 5th installment of this mega battle contest pits teams from Vans, Nike SB, DC, Adidas, and etnies in specific skate challenges all over the British Isles. London/South East, Bristol/South West, Yorkshire/Teesside, Manchester/North West, the Midlands and Scotland are all open territory for a range of missions from never been done tricks at famous skate spots, to an obscure trick-list to finding new spot and shredding them. Sponsored by Sidewalk Magazine, the winning team will score the cover of the mag and get primo shine in the accompanying DVD. Go here for more.

The Snow Centre | Indoor Mountain

08 April 2009, 18.51 | Posted in Architecture, resorts, snowboarding | No comments »

Rad Collector - Snow Center
No mountains, no problem. A new indoor snow facility, called The Snow Centre will open on May 6 in the city of Hemel Hempstead, an hour north of London. The £23 million structure has a 160 meter main slope and a 12 month membership costs £100. Between this place and the upcoming Xanadu complex at the Meadowlands, lets hope a trend towards eliminating the natural elements does not continue to catch on with developers. Sure its great to shred all year, and not having to worry about the weather sounds awesome, but if people start forgetting about the mountains, its a wrap. They’re the whole reason we ride.
